Time Type: Full Time Purpose of Position Achieve maximum customer satisfaction and profitability/growth from assigned key accounts by continuous expansion of business relations. Deliver financial results in-line with agreed budgets and targets.
Key Tasks Customer Engagement

  • Manage a favorable commercial relationship with assigned account that will promote customer satisfaction, business growth and profitability.
  • Ensure all assigned accounts are managed and developed in line with the established corporate/regional strategies and all key performance indicators stipulated in the contract are fulfilled.
  • Conduct business reviews, analyze and identify business opportunities, potential risks and make appropriate recommendation to management.
  • Responsible for a smooth business implementation and handover of SOPs to operations and ongoing monitoring of compliance.
  • Ensure compliance with operational processes by performing process monitoring and close follow-up with respective parties.
  • Propose objectives for each assigned account(s).

Accounts Management
  • Attend monthly/quarterly/annual customer review meetings
  • Ensure monthly/quarterly/annual Business Review meetings take place, are well-prepared and all relevant stakeholders involved in a timely manner
  • Ensure minutes from Monthly, Quarterly and Yearly Business Review Meetings are distributed to all relevant stakeholders (Products, Regions) and corrective actions are followed up for Country Key Accounts and sizeable Country Accounts where applicable
  • Ensure any concerns and/or complaints from customer are timely escalated to all relevant stakeholders (Products, Regions)

Opportunity Management
  • Ensure all opportunities are created and tracked through CRM
  • Ensure all Country RFQ opportunities follow the Tender Management process including timely pre-RFQ strategy and alignment with Product
  • Align and agree on strategic bid prioritization with product and/or Global/Regional team
  • Ensure RFI & RFQ post-bid analysis is created and shared and corrective actions are aligned and agreed

Quality & Performance Management
  • Maintain continuous close collaboration with operations team to contribute in performance excellence and/or quality improvement programs for all assigned accounts.
  • Perform quality and timely update and maintenance of the data in Sales system (MS Dynamics) and monitor use of Customer Applications.

Competencies
  • Self-motivated and self-disciplined
  • Ability to manage cross-functional interfaces (Operations and ISPs)
  • Self-management (Planning, Organizing & Goal Setting, Execution)
  • Good interpersonal and written and verbal communication skills
  • Customer focus
  • Team player
  • Problem-solving skills
  • Organized, flexible and able to prioritize work under tight deadlines
  • Administration skills

Experience & Education
  • Functional experience in air / sea / customs brokerage
  • Basic sales knowledge
  • Expertise and professionalism in customer contacts, understanding of customer requirements, analysis and resolution of problems and complaints
  • Local market knowledge (customers, competitors, suppliers)
  • Understanding of DSV service offering and pricing policy
  • Understanding of DSV (strategy, products and solutions)
  • Degree Holder or Diploma with leadership quality can be considered
  • At least 4 years of relevant business experience
  • High competency with MS Office (Word, Excel & Powerpoint)
DSV – Global transport and logistics DSV is one of the very best performing companies in the transport and logistics industry. 75,000 employees in more than 90 countries work passionately to deliver great customer experiences and high-quality services – as part of the operation or in a variety of supporting roles.
